I have been out trying to get the engine and tranny to fit today, with no luck.. i need to do somthing to the oil pan and the transmission tunnel and the assesorisse the altrernator is in the way

.. so now my god deal is not so god anymore...when you look from the side on the car the oil pan on the transmission is very deep to, so im not sure if i can hVE 3 degrees on it..